A Most Violent Year
from RollTheCredits's podcast · host Frank DiSalvo and Zach Johnson
How do you create a mafia film without actually being about the mob? J.C Chandor was able to do so by creating a story about a heating oil company that follows an immigrant and his wife looking to expand their business while keeping competitors at bay. A film with beautiful shots, an interesting story, and well-executed dialogue. There is not much to hate about this film other than the name might not warrant the film itself. Nevertheless, this is definitely a film to check out because when it feels scary to jump,that is exactly when you jump.
